National Minority Health Month happens in April of every year. Established in April 2001 by the National Minority Health Month Structure, National Minority Health Month is a yearly occasion committed to raising awareness for and attending to the health variations that impact ethnic and racial minorities. Disparities in health care have actually been
and continue to be deeply common for minority groups, and we should work to bridge these spaces. It’s time to produce a future with better health and health care resources. In observance of National Minority Health Month, let’s put in the time to discuss what disparities in healthcare can appear like for minority groups and how to resolve them not simply in April however throughout the year.

Defend Inclusivity In Educational And Professional Settings.
We need to continue to broaden resources for people who want to join the medical or mental health field that belongs of minority groups, as this becomes part of how we bridge the gaps. Different research studies have found that when someone can access a doctor or another doctor who is part of the exact same minority group, they get more effective care. If you belong to a minority group yourself, this is one way to advocate yourself and potentially get care. Examples of experts you might try to find that are of the same minority group include however aren’t limited to primary care physicians, psychological health counselors and therapists, psychiatrists, massage therapists, and dietitians. This can be done through a web search, or sometimes, through a service provider directory.

If you belong to a minority group, it is necessary to look after yourself – whatever that means for you. It can be difficult and even tiring to promote for yourself sometimes, and it is necessary to have tools for self-care and to cope in place. Social support and community can be extremely essential, which one might discover face-to-face or online by means of support groups and other avenues. Often, there are support system for people in minority groups dealing with particular concerns, which can provide an essential sense of connection.
